Arizona Fails to Pass Bill to Legalize Cruising

Arizona failed to pass a SAN-supported bill (H.B. 2332) to allow automobile cruising activities to return statewide. Currently, local authorities are authorized to pass ordinances that regulate or prohibit cruising. This effort follows similar legislation approved in California last year.  The bill passed the full House, but the Senate Committee on Transportation, Technology and Missing Children failed to advance the bill.
